About This Site

Beaconsfield Garden Centre, London Road, Beaconsfield is a brownfield development site covering 2.50 hectares. The site has potential for up to 9 new homes.

The site has outline planning permission, granted on 27/04/2016.

Additional Notes

Application for reserved matters following outline planning permission 15/02142/OUT (Erection of 9 dwellings, formation of new access and associated driveway and alterations to garden centre carpark) and to allow the discharge of conditions 4, 8, 10 and 11 of the outline permission.

What is Brownfield Land?

Brownfield land is previously developed land that may be available for redevelopment. The government prioritises brownfield development over greenfield sites to protect countryside and make efficient use of existing infrastructure. Local authorities maintain Brownfield Land Registers to identify suitable sites for housing.
